What should I do if the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 power tool plug does not match the outlet?

Power tool plugs must match the outlet. Never modify the plug in any way. Do not use any adapter plugs with earthed (grounded) power tools. Unmodified plugs and matching outlets will reduce the risk of electric shock for the BLACK & DECKER QS1000.


What should I do to prevent electric shock when operating the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 near earthed surfaces?

Avoid body contact with earthed or grounded surfaces such as pipes, radiators, ranges and refrigerators when operating the BLACK & DECKER QS1000. There is an increased risk of electric shock if your body is earthed or grounded.


What should I do to reduce the risk of electric shock when operating the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 outdoors?

When operating the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 outdoors, use an extension cord suitable for outdoor use. Use of a cord suitable for outdoor use reduces the risk of electric shock.


What should I do if operating the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 in a damp location is unavoidable?

If operating the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 in a damp location is unavoidable, use a residual current device (RCD) protected supply. Use of an RCD reduces the risk of electric shock.


What personal safety equipment should I use when operating the BLACK & DECKER QS1000?

Use personal protective equipment when operating the BLACK & DECKER QS1000. Always wear eye, ear and respiratory protection. Protective equipment such as dust mask, non-skid safety shoes, hard hat, or hearing protection used for appropriate conditions will reduce personal injuries.


How do I prevent unintentional starting of the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 power tool?

Ensure the switch is in the off-position before connecting to the power source and/or battery pack, picking up or carrying the BLACK & DECKER QS1000. Carrying power tools with your finger on the switch or energising power tools that have the switch on invites accidents.


What should I do before turning on the BLACK & DECKER QS1000?

Remove any adjusting key or wrench before turning the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 power tool on. A wrench or a key left attached to a rotating part of the power tool may result in personal injury.


What should I do to maintain proper control of the BLACK & DECKER QS1000?

Do not overreach when operating the BLACK & DECKER QS1000. Keep proper footing and balance at all times. This enables better control of the power tool in unexpected situations.


What clothing should I avoid when using the BLACK & DECKER QS1000?

Do not wear loose clothing or jewellery when using the BLACK & DECKER QS1000. Keep your hair, clothing and gloves away from moving parts. Loose clothes, jewellery or long hair can be caught in moving parts.


What should I do if the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 power tool has a defective switch?

Do not use the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 power tool if the switch does not turn it on and off. Any power tool that cannot be controlled with the switch is dangerous and must be repaired.


What should I do before making adjustments or changing accessories on the BLACK & DECKER QS1000?

Disconnect the plug from the power source and/or the battery pack from the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 power tool before making any adjustments, changing accessories, or storing power tools. Such preventive safety measures reduce the risk of starting the power tool accidentally.


How should I store the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 when not in use?

Store the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 power tools out of the reach of children and do not allow persons unfamiliar with the power tool or these instructions to operate the power tool. Power tools are dangerous in the hands of untrained users.


How should I maintain the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 power tool?

Check for misalignment or binding of moving parts, breakage of parts and any other condition that may affect the operation of the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 power tool. If damaged, have the power tool repaired before use. Many accidents are caused by poorly maintained power tools.


How should I use the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 power tool and its accessories?

Use the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 power tool, accessories and tool bits etc., in accordance with these instructions, taking into account the working conditions and the work to be performed. Use of the power tool for operations different from those intended could result in a hazardous situation.


Who should service the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 power tool?

Have the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 power tool serviced by a qualified repair person using only identical replacement parts. This will ensure that the safety of the power tool is maintained.

How do I fit the sanding sheet onto the BLACK & DECKER QS1000?

Soften the sanding sheet by rubbing its non-abrasive side over the edge of a work table.

Press the paper clamp levers (6) upwards to release them from the retaining grooves and open the paper clamps by pressing them down.

Place the sheet onto the sanding base.

Insert the edge of the sanding sheet into the front paper clamp as shown.

Press the front paper clamp lever (6) downwards and locate it in the retaining groove.

While keeping a slight tension on the sheet, insert the rear edge of the sheet into the rear paper clamp.

Press the rear paper clamp lever (6) downwards and locate it in the retaining groove.


How do I use the paper punch for the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 sanding sheets?

The paper punch (7) is used for punching dust extraction holes in sanding sheets without pre-punched holes.

Fit a sanding sheet.

Hold the tool in position right above the paper punch (7).

Press the tool with the sanding base (5) down into the paper punch.

Take the tool off the paper punch (7) and check whether the holes in the sanding sheet have been fully pierced.

How often should I empty the dust canister (3) on the BLACK & DECKER QS1000?

The dust canister on the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 should be emptied every 10 minutes.


What are the steps to empty the dust canister (3) on the BLACK & DECKER QS1000?

Pull the dust canister (3) to the rear and off the tool.

Remove the cover (2) by twisting it counterclockwise.

Hold dust canister with the filter (8) facing down and shake the canister (3) to empty the contents.

Shake the cover (2) to empty the contents.

Refit the cover (2) onto the dust canister (3), twisting it clockwise until it locks into place.

Fit the dust canister (3) onto the tool.


How should I clean the dust canister filter (8) for the BLACK & DECKER QS1000?

To reduce the risk of personal injury, do not use compressed air to clean the filter (8) on the BLACK & DECKER QS1000.

Do not use a brush or sharp objects to clean the filter as these items can reduce the durability of the filter material. Do not wash the filter.

The dust canister filter (8) is re-usable and should be cleaned regularly.

Empty the dust canister (3) as described above.

Pull the dust canister filter (8) off the dust canister (3).

Shake off the excess dust by tapping the filter (8) into a trash can.

Replace the dust canister filter (8).

Fit the cover (2).

Fit the dust canister (3) onto the tool.


What are the hints for optimum use when operating the BLACK & DECKER QS1000?

Do not place your hands over the ventilation slots on the BLACK & DECKER QS1000.

Do not exert too much pressure on the tool.

Regularly check the condition of the sanding sheet. Replace when necessary.

Always sand with the grain of the wood.

When sanding new layers of paint before applying another layer, use extra fine grit.

On very uneven surfaces, or when removing layers of paint, start with a coarse grit. On other surfaces, start with a medium grit. In both cases, gradually change to a fine grit for a smooth finish.


What should I be aware of regarding fire hazard when using the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 for dust collection?

Collected sanding dust from sanding surface coatings (polyurethane, linseed oil, etc.) can self-ignite in the sander dust canister or elsewhere and cause fire when using the BLACK & DECKER QS1000. To reduce risk, empty canister frequently and strictly follow sander manual and coating manufacturer’s instructions.

When working on metal surfaces with the BLACK & DECKER QS1000, do not use the dust canister or a vacuum cleaner because sparks are generated. Wear safety glasses and a dustmask. Due to the danger of fire, do not use your sander to sand magnesium surfaces. Do not use for wet sanding.

What is the troubleshooting step if the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 unit will not start?

The possible causes and solutions if the BLACK & DECKER QS1000 unit will not start are:

Problem Possible Cause Possible Solution
Unit will not start. Cord not plugged in. Plug tool into a working outlet.
Circuit fuse is blown. Replace circuit fuse. (If the product repeatedly causes the circuit fuse to blow, discontinue use immediately and have it serviced at a Black & Decker service center or authorized servicer.)
Circuit breaker is tripped. Reset circuit breaker. (If the product repeatedly causes the circuit breaker to trip, discontinue use immediately and have it serviced at a Black & Decker service center or authorized servicer.)
Cord or switch is damaged. Have cord or switch replaced at Black & Decker Service Center or Authorized Servicer.
